AGNES B. WHEELER
December 25, 1927 – January 6, 2023
Washingtonville, NY formerly Cornwall, NY

Agnes B. Wheeler, a former Cornwall, NY resident, entered into eternal rest on January 6, 2023 at Montefiore St. Luke’s Cornwall Hospital, Newburgh, NY. She was 95 years old.

The daughter of the late Franz and Eva Gruber, Agnes was born on December 25, 1927 in Nurnberg, Germany. She was a Member of St. Thomas of Canterbury Parish since her arrival in Cornwall in 1965 and pledged support in the building of the new church.

Agnes was a kind and generous woman who lived a simple life. She loved knitting and sewing. Her greatest riches in life involved spending time with her family. Her long life blessed her with grandchildren and great-grandchildren who will always remember and cherish the memories spent with their “Oma”. She missed her loving husband George for 27 years and now they are together. She will be forever in our hearts.

In addition to her parents, Agnes was predeceased by her loving husband: George L. Wheeler. She is survived by her daughter: Susanna M. (Wheeler) Offerman and her husband Wayne of Washingtonville, NY; her son: Ronald Wheeler and his wife Penney of Rockport, TX; her grandchildren: Kelly and Christopher Offerman; and 3 great grandchildren: Olivia, James and Hailey.
